What the medication is used for
B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P is used to numb (anaesthetise) part of the body during surgery and also for pain relief. B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P can be used to:
- numb the area of the body where surgery is to be performed.
- provide pain relief in labour.
- provide pain relief after surgery.
- provide pain relief after an injury.
What it does
B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P works by temporarily blocking the nerves in the area it is injected so you do not feel pain, heat or cold. This makes the area numb and relieves pain. You may still feel pressure and touch. In many cases the nerves to the muscles in the area will also be blocked. This can cause temporary weakness or paralysis.
When it should not be used
Do not use B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P if you are allergic (hypersensitive) to:
- bupivacaine hydrochloride
- any other “-caine” type anaesthetics
- any of the non-medicinal ingredients in the product, or component of the container (see above)
What the medicinal ingredient is
Bupivacaine hydrochloride.
What the non-medicinal ingredients are
Sodium chloride, sodium hydroxide and/or hydrochloric acid and water for injection.
What dosage form it comes in
Sterile solution packed in single-use glass vials available in two strengths:
- 0.25% (2.5 mg/mL).
- 0.5% (5 mg/mL).

Other warnings you should know about
Driving and using machines: B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P can affect your level of alertness, your reactions and your coordination. You should use caution driving and when operating tools or machinery on the day you receive B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P.
Because of the potential for irreversible joint damage, B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P should not be used to treat pain following joint surgery.
B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P is not to be used in children under 2 years of age.
The safety and efficacy of B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P has not been established in children 2 - 12 years of age. B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P should only be used in this age group if the benefit outweighs the risk.

Overdose
If you think you have taken too much B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P contact your healthcare professional, hospital emergency department or regional poison control centre immediately, even if there are no symptoms.
The first signs that too much BUPIVACAINE INJECTION BP has been given are: lightheadedness, numbness of the lips and around the mouth, numbness of the tongue, hearing disturbances, ringing in the ears, and visual disturbances. Symptoms that are more serious include speech problems, muscle twitching and tremors. Tell your healthcare professional immediately if you notice any of these symptoms.
In the case of a serious overdose or a misplaced injection, trembling, seizures or unconsciousness may occur.
